Monday•Friday | 9:00 AM•5:00 PM Position Overview We are seeking an experienced Case Worker to provide social service support, care coordination, and resource management services. This role focuses on assessing client needs, coordinating community resources, supporting public assistance programs, and maintaining accurate case documentation. The ideal candidate will possess strong organizational, communication, and case management skills with experience working in healthcare or social service environments. Responsibilities Conduct assessments to identify social service and resource needs. Develop, implement, and monitor individualized service plans. Assist clients with public assistance, food stamps, medical benefits, and community resources. Evaluate eligibility for social service programs and support services. Provide guidance, counseling, and referrals to appropriate resources. Coordinate services with healthcare providers, agencies, and community organizations. Maintain accurate case records, documentation, and reports. Perform data entry and case tracking within electronic systems. Utilize EPIC and CarePort systems for care coordination and documentation. Investigate and assess social service concerns and client needs. Assist individuals requiring institutional care or protective services. Monitor case progress and ensure timely follow-up activities. Maintain confidentiality and comply with organizational policies and procedures. Required Qualifications Bachelor's Degree from an accredited college or university. Minimum 3 years of case management, social services, or related experience. Experience working with public assistance, healthcare, or community service programs. EPIC experience required or highly preferred. Strong documentation, data entry, and case tracking skills. Experience coordinating services for diverse populations. Ability to work onsite Monday through Friday. Preferred Qualifications Degree in Social Work, Human Services, Psychology, Sociology, or related field. CarePort experience. Social service or case management certifications. Experience in hospital, community health, or public assistance settings.
